RANGELEY – An evening of lighthearted fun with improvisational interpretations of Sonny and Cher, Mae West, Roy Orbeson, Britney Spears or perhaps Patsy Cline is on tap for Saturday and Sunday, Feb. 14-15, at the Club House.

Musicians, poets, performers, artists and singers who have chosen to live in Maine for the quality of life offered will take the stage at 7 p.m. in the production called DIVA. They each will have chosen a celebrity they wish to emulate, selected a song to belt out and created a costume to pull their act together.

The show is a fundraiser for Rangeley High School’s Project Graduation and the high school’s chorus. For tickets, call the Rangeley Lakes Chamber of Commerce at 864-5364.
